Lieutenant Governor Manoj Sinha Attends Navkar Mahamantra Divas Celebration

In a spiritually uplifting gathering held at Raj Bhavan today, Lieutenant Governor Manoj Sinha joined devotees and dignitaries from various walks of life to mark the grand celebration of Navkar Mahamantra Divas. The event witnessed participation from members of the Jain International Trade Organization, spiritual leaders, and officials from numerous organizations.

The Lieutenant Governor extended his warm greetings to all participants, highlighting the timeless spiritual significance of the Navkar Mahamantra, one of the most revered mantras in Jainism.

“For thousands of years, sacred mantras have guided seekers on the path of truth and divinity. Among them, the aura and spiritual essence of the Navkar Mahamantra are truly unique,” said Lt. Governor Sinha, addressing the gathering.

He described the mantra as an embodiment of inner transformation and awakening, emphasizing its universal message of love, harmony, and selfless service.

“Where there is love and harmony, there is God. True power lies in a heart full of goodwill. These are the values that uplift humanity,” he said. “The greatest purpose of life is selfless service to society and the welfare of all living beings.”

The celebration was part of a global initiative involving people from over 108 countries who participated simultaneously in the collective chanting of the mantra, promoting a powerful message of peace, unity, and self-purification.

The event inspired individuals to reflect deeply on values such as tolerance, compassion, and spiritual awareness, fostering a strong sense of universal brotherhood.

As the sacred chants echoed through Raj Bhavan, the atmosphere was filled with tranquility and devotion, symbolizing the enduring spiritual heritage of India.
